Natl Chicken Foot Eating Contest Saturday, September 12th, Corozal Central Park, 5pm-9pm Art in the Park at Corozal Central Park. This is a monthly event that draws artists and craftspeople from all of Corozal District and beyond. Besides the sale of lovely artwork, there are also vendors for food and refreshments, and often live performances. Call 620-1572 or visit the Corozal House of Culture. St George’s Caye Day 2019 Corozal Town celebrated the 221st anniversary of the Battle of St George’s Caye with a ceremony including coronation of the Corozal Queen of the Bay and a parade. The Belize Diabetes Association, Corozal Branch, along with schools and villages throughout the Corozal District, called attention to diabetes with a program and walkathon in Corozal Town.
